Latest Patents

Among his notable inventions, two of Dimitrios' latest patents include a digital speech coder with different excitation types and voice synthesis utilizing multi-level filter excitation. The first patent presents a system where pitch information is transmitted during voiced segments of speech, and modified residual information during unvoiced segments. This sophisticated method utilizes a pitch detection circuit for accurate analysis and synthesis. The latter patent focuses on smart decision-making during the transmission of excitation types based on the characteristics of the speech signal. By comparing the variance of the residual against the mean amplitude, the system effectively utilizes pulse or noise excitation to enhance speech quality.

Career Highlights

Throughout his career, Dimitrios Prezas has worked at prestigious organizations such as AT&T Bell Laboratories and American Telephone & Telegraph Company. His time at AT&T Bell Laboratories provided him with a platform to explore groundbreaking innovations, leading to his current standing as a reputable figure in the field of telecommunications and speech processing.

Collaborations

Dimitrios has collaborated with esteemed colleagues including Walter T Hartwell and Joseph Picone. Their combined efforts in research and development have contributed significantly to advances in voice technology, showcasing the value of teamwork in the innovation process.
